Weather in Miami is warm to hot during the entire year. The hottest and most humid season is summer, which is also hurricane season. Any time you visit Miami, be prepared for some rain by bringing an umbrella and a rain jacket. Pack lots of warm weather clothing, including shorts, t-shirts, tank tops, and sundresses and you’ll be comfortable year round!
WINTER – December, January, February:
Winter is the tourist season in Miami, as it’s cold and snowy in the rest of the country! This is when prices will be the highest and crowds of tourists will flock to the beaches. Don’t expect too much rain during the winter months. Daytime temperatures will be warm and will cool down slightly at night.
SPRING – March, April, May:
Spring is arguably the most pleasant month to travel to Miami. The weather is warm but not hot and you won’t experience too much rain, as hurricane season has not yet begun. Be sure to bring a light jacket to wear in the evenings when temperatures cool down.
SUMMER – June, July, August:
Summer temperatures in Miami can be excruciatingly hot and humid, and as it is also hurricane season, you can expect it to rain at least once every day. Though there may not be any hurricanes, you should always be prepared for one during this season.
FALL – September, October, November :
Hurricane season in Miami lasts through November, so expect there to be an abundance of rain and humidity throughout the fall. Hotel prices are down, there are less crowds, and the weather is still hot, making this season an ideal time to visit Miami and hit the beach.
